KEMBAR78
🚨 Remove DoLa decoding strategy by manueldeprada · Pull Request #40082 · huggingface/transformers · GitHub
Skip to content

Conversation

@manueldeprada
Copy link
Contributor

@manueldeprada manueldeprada commented Aug 11, 2025

Removes Decoding by Contrasting Layers (DoLa) generation strategy from the codebase. Directs users to the transformers-community/dola repository.

It has been a warning for a few releases, but now trust_remote_code=True is required to run DoLa generation.

@HuggingFaceDocBuilderDev

The docs for this PR live here. All of your documentation changes will be reflected on that endpoint. The docs are available until 30 days after the last update.

@manueldeprada manueldeprada requested a review from gante August 21, 2025 10:05
@manueldeprada manueldeprada marked this pull request as ready for review August 21, 2025 10:58
Copy link
Member

@gante gante left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ks mostly good to me, added two minor nits :) I've also checked the repo itself, and I'm quite happy with it!

👉 Sanity-check question: if you add trust_remote_code=True on the mixin test (test_dola_decoding_sample), do the tests still pass? Let's confirm this 🤗 (I see you did it in the integration tests 👍 )
👉 merging: we'll need to move the repo under transformers-community before merging, let's take care of it tomorrow!

@manueldeprada manueldeprada changed the title Removes DoLa decoding strategy 🚨 Remove DoLa decoding strategy Aug 25, 2025
@gante
Copy link
Member

gante commented Aug 25, 2025

@manueldeprada happy with the new test! Feel free to merge 🤗

(I've also added DoLa to the collection in transformers-community)

@github-actions
Copy link
Contributor

[For maintainers] Suggested jobs to run (before merge)

run-slow: aria, csm, deepseek_v3, dia, gemma, gemma3n, git, granitemoe, granitemoeshared, llama, mistral, qwen2_5_omni, recurrent_gemma

@manueldeprada manueldeprada merged commit ea8d9c8 into huggingface:main Aug 25, 2025
24 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ants